Sample Questions

1multiple correct
1 marks

Which of these should be in a first aid kit?

Show answer

Cotton,Scissors,Antiseptic solution

A first aid kit must have cotton, scissors, and antiseptic solution to treat minor injuries.

2true false
1 marks

True or False: You can take medicine on your own if you feel sick.

Show answer

False

Medicines should only be taken when given by an elder or doctor, as wrong doses can be harmful.

3multiple choice
1 marks

Which of these is a good touch?

Show answer

A gentle pat on the back from a parent

A gentle touch from a loved one like a parent is a good touch that makes us feel safe.

4multiple choice
1 marks

What should you do if someone gives you a bad touch?

Show answer

Shout, run away, and tell a trusted adult

If someone gives a bad touch, you must shout, run away, and tell a trusted adult like a parent or teacher.
